Search volatility is how much rankings in Google's results move up and down over a short time. A little movement is normal every day. When lots of sites shift at once, it usually means Google is testing or rolling out a change to its ranking systems, and your site's visibility can change with it.

Mostly, wait. Hold off on big site changes, check your rankings more often, and write down anything that moves. Rankings often bounce around while an update rolls out and settle later, so judge the real impact after the volatility calms down, not during it.

Google algorithm volatility is the ranking movement caused by changes to Google's ranking systems. Google adjusts its algorithm constantly, and the bigger changes shake up results across whole industries at once. A SERP volatility tracker like Zutrix Tension measures that shake-up and turns it into a simple score.
Check the tension score at the top of this page. A high score means search results are moving more than normal, which often points to an update in progress. Google only confirms some of its updates, so volatility trackers are usually the earliest signal you'll get.
